What is Word Search Games for Seniors

Word search games are perfect for seniors, offering both entertainment and cognitive benefits. These puzzles typically feature a grid of letters where players must find hidden words related to a given theme or category. For seniors, these games provide an engaging way to exercise the mind without requiring complex instructions.

Benefits for Seniors

  • Mental Stimulation: Word searches help keep the brain active and engaged, which can be crucial in maintaining cognitive function as one ages.
  • Stress Relief: Solving puzzles can be a relaxing activity that helps reduce stress and improve overall mood.
  • Memory Improvement: Regularly playing word search games can enhance memory retention and recall abilities.
  • Social Interaction: Many seniors enjoy sharing their progress or competing with friends, making these games a fun social activity.
  • Game Features

    - Customizable Themes: Games often offer themes like holidays, animals, nature, and more, allowing players to choose topics that interest them. - Progress Tracking: Some platforms track your progress over time, showing improvements in speed and accuracy, which can be motivating. - Accessibility Options: Many word search games include features such as adjustable text size, voice instructions, or color contrasts for better visibility.

    How to Play

  • Start with a Grid: Each game presents a grid of letters where hidden words are placed horizontally, vertically, or diagonally.
  • Find the Words: Look for words related to the theme provided at the top or bottom of the screen.
  • Mark Your Findings: Once you find a word, mark it by circling or underlining it.

    Tips and Tricks to Get Better at Word Search Games for Seniors

    Word search games are not only fun but also offer great cognitive benefits, especially for seniors. Here are some tips to enhance your skills and enjoy the game even more:

  • Start with Smaller Grids: If you're new to word searches or find them challenging, begin with smaller grids. This will help you get a feel for the layout and improve your speed as you progress.
  • Use a Pencil: Instead of using your fingers or just looking at the grid, use a pencil to circle words as you find them. This not only helps in keeping track but also makes it easier to spot patterns and connections between letters.
  • Look for Patterns: Pay attention to repeated letters or common letter combinations. For example, "S" often appears before "T" in many English words. Recognizing these patterns can help you spot words faster.
  • Practice Regularly: Like any skill, regular practice improves your ability. Set aside a few minutes each day to play word search games. This will not only improve your speed but also increase your vocabulary over time.
  • Use Mnemonics: Create mnemonic devices for difficult or longer words. For instance, if you struggle with the word "onomatopoeia," think of it as "ono-mato-POE-ia" to break it down into manageable parts.
  • Join a Community: Engage in online forums or social media groups dedicated to word searches. Sharing tips and strategies can provide new insights and keep you motivated.
  • Set Goals: Challenge yourself by setting goals, such as finding all the words within a certain time limit or completing more complex grids each day. This can make the game more engaging and rewarding.
